Subject: ws compression tradeoffs — Relayline gateway

Team, quick summary for the sync. Enabling permessage-deflate on Relayline cuts bandwidth ~38% but adds 12–15ms p99 latency and raises memory per connection noticeably. Proposal: enable only for payloads >4KB, keep small frames uncompressed. Rollout behind a flag next week, canary on the Ostram cluster first. Benchmarks came from the staging run; the build token is below.

trace token, fafog-kageg: htk4_98e6

## Runbook: tax-rate lookup cache (Ledgerpine)

The tax-rate cache refreshes hourly from the rates service. If lookups return stale jurisdictions, flush the cache with the admin endpoint and confirm the refresh job logged a successful pull. Do not flush during month-end close without flagging it at the sync. If the refresh job itself is stuck, restart it and verify it can reach the rates database using the connection string below.

replica DSN, kajep-yahag: mssql://praok_svc:iF@db-8d68.plorvaio.local:5432/eliion

## Partner SFTP Drop — Meralux Exchange

Inbound files from partner Teslin Freight arrive nightly on the Meralux SFTP drop and are swept into the ingest queue by the `dropwatch` job. Review the host fingerprint pinning in `dropwatch.conf` before approving changes; fingerprint rotation requires sign-off from the data handling lead. The job reads all connection settings from its environment file, and the passphrase protecting the private key is set on the line immediately following.

vault entry, yahaf-tagug: LEDGER_TOKEN20=884d77d1a8b98aa4edfb